IHCL to open Vivanta Hotel in Vellore

The company has partnered with BBK Group to establish the greenfield venture in the district.

CHENNAI: The Indian Hotels Company Ltd will set up a 100-key Vivanta hotel in Vellore, marking its maiden entry into the city, a top official said.

The company has partnered with BBK Group to establish the greenfield venture in the district.

IHCL EVP (Real Estate and Development) Suma Venkatesh said Vellore with robust infra is a promising hospitality market.

“Its inclusion in the Smart Cities Mission reflects the city’s growth potential,” she said, expressing delight in partnering with BBK Group promoter Baskaran on the project.
